Lauren’s Patisserie, Drumcliffe, Co Sligo
Laura McLoughlin, a qualified pastry chef with more than 10 years experience at some of the world’s most celebrated patisseries, is opening her own cake and coffee shop on Valentine’s Day. A native of Drumcliffe, Lauren honed her skills at renowned establishments including Le Petit Caporal in France, Peggy Porschen in London, Gleneagles in Scotland and Ashford Castle here in Ireland.
Lauren was working in London when she came home for a holiday in 2020 and couldn’t return because of the pandemic. She had always wanted to run her own business, so she began wholesaling desserts to hotels, cafés and restaurants. She now has clients nationwide, sourcing the highest-quality ingredients including Benbulben eggs, and the finest Belgian chocolate and cocoa powder. She also caters for weddings and corporate events.

Old Fashioned Sam’s & Laura’s Restaurant, Dublin
Dublin’s newest multi-storey destination, Old Fashioned Sam’s has unveiled its new rooftop restaurant, Laura’s. Renovated from a former pub, guests can enjoy a ground-floor cocktail bar that opens into Dublin’s largest heated courtyard (with a retractable roof for warmer days), a café-style front bar perfect for lunch and Sam’s parlour: an intimate bar with a 1920s speakeasy aesthetic. Expect seasonal menus including fillet steak, lobster bisque, pan-fried Halibut, tuna tartare and grilled gambas. @lauras.restaurant
Brother Bean, Ballinteer Road, Dublin
Ballinteer locals delight as a new quality coffee spot has opened right in the neighbourhood. Brother Bean café also serves as a mobile café, coffee educator and retailer, with its goal to make great coffee accessible. It brings its speciality Creed Coffee, delicious baked goods from Rua Foods and Golden Brown sandwiches – who specialise in creating gourmet toasties using a combination of fresh, local, Irish produce and high-quality Italian ingredients, artisan sourdough from Bretzel Bakery and cheese from West Cork. Pop-up Event: Another Sunday Lunch, Mowgli, Dublin
Mowgli, a roaming kitchen of produce lead cooking, will stop off at Leonard’s Corner on February 23. Mowgli is the project of Tom Hayes, whose cooking is shaped by his time at Ballymaloe Cookery School, The River Café in London, Surt in Copenhagen, and most recently Allta in Dublin. Mowgli has popped up in some special places — an open-fire lunch at Body & Soul, a long-table feast in a 400-year-old hay shed, and a weekend of natural wine and clams at Dick Mack’s in Dingle. @mowglibusiness
